Product Name: PVC Textile Picnic Blanket
Classification HS CODEs and Tax Details:
✅ HS CODE: 3921.12.19.50
Description:
- This code applies to PVC (polyvinyl chloride) textile picnic blankets that are coated or combined with textile materials, but do not meet the criteria where textile fibers exceed the weight of any single textile fiber.
Tariff Breakdown:
- Base Tariff Rate: 5.3%
- Additional Tariff (General): 25.0%
- Special Tariff after April 11, 2025: 30.0%
- Total Tax Rate: 60.3%
✅ HS CODE: 3921.12.11.00
Description:
- Applies to PVC textile composite picnic mats where plastic (PVC) constitutes more than 70% of the weight, and the product is combined with textile materials.
Tariff Breakdown:
- Base Tariff Rate: 4.2%
- Additional Tariff (General): 25.0%
- Special Tariff after April 11, 2025: 30.0%
- Total Tax Rate: 59.2%
✅ HS CODE: 3921.12.19.10
Description:
- Applies to thick PVC textile picnic mats where textile fibers (vegetable fibers) exceed the weight of any other single textile fiber.
Tariff Breakdown:
- Base Tariff Rate: 5.3%
- Additional Tariff (General): 25.0%
- Special Tariff after April 11, 2025: 30.0%
- Total Tax Rate: 60.3%
📌 Key Notes and Recommendations:
- Material Composition:
-
Confirm the weight percentage of PVC vs. textile materials. This will determine whether the product falls under 3921.12.19.10 (textile fiber dominates) or 3921.12.19.50 (PVC dominates).
-
Tariff Changes After April 11, 2025:
-
A 30% additional tariff will be applied to all products under these HS codes. Ensure your pricing and compliance strategy accounts for this.
-
Certifications and Documentation:
- Verify if certifications (e.g., textile content, PVC content) are required for customs clearance.
-
Ensure product descriptions clearly state the material composition and weight percentages to avoid misclassification.
-
Anti-Dumping Duties:
- No specific anti-dumping duties are mentioned for this product category, but always check the latest customs announcements for any updates.
